Hi and welcome,
Your concerns are valid so maybe talk to your vet a bit more to see when it would be appropriate.
I don't remember when Duke got his rabies shot but it's around that if not 6 months. He was around the same weight as yours. He did not have any bad reactions, I always make sure that I'm free for atleast the rest of the day to spend with them after shots. Regardless of what shot you get, some dogs might have a reactions while others might not. I think that if you speak to your vet and monitor your pup afterward for changes then you'll be ok.
I'm sure you know this but if you choose to wait to have the shot just don't have your pup near other dogs until all shots are completed. They are so small and we wouldn't want to risk any chances.
